SUB's 250-1,500 ml Working Volume 

CellVessel 21-2000 with circular stator generating radial media mixing cultivating CHO cells on DasGip MP8 Process-Control-System. Test performed at Bioneer A/S, Denmark, senior scientist Holger K. Riemann, www.bioneer.dk. Conclusion is that mass transfer is significant higher allowing cells to grow faster and obtain max density followed by excess lactate concentration.
